He seems very black and White and I feel he wouldn't be able to see Rand as a hero if "for the greater good" was an acceptable viewpoint. With SL and Dark Rand and the fact that IMO perfectly acceptable (as well as a couple of incidences of dubious) "hardening" was seen as evil on Rand's part we see this as a major theme in the book and RJ's characters couldn't have made harder choices and still been the good guys in his world. Despite that, Rand does make hard choices, and is criticised for it, does kill rulers as far ad he knew at the time (Aslasam) and in his eyes people dying because of him and his actions is as bad as him killing them ( a moral stance I sympathise and partially agree with) and plenty die because of that
